
Edge analytics
Edge analytics refers to processing data close to where it is generated, such as sensors or devices, rather than sending it all to a centralized cloud or data center. This approach allows for faster decision-making, reduced data transmission costs, and increased privacy. For example, in a factory, sensors can analyze machine performance locally to detect issues promptly, enabling quick responses and minimizing downtime. Edge analytics enhances efficiency and responsiveness by enabling intelligent, real-time insights directly at the data source.
